Summary of Industrial Wooden Pallets
Wooden pallets are flat transport structures made from wood, developed to support items in a stable style while they are being lifted by forklifts, pallet jacks, or other jacking devices. They are available in various sizes and are normally built from softwood or hardwood materials, each offering distinct benefits for different applications.

[Industrial wooden pallets](https://git.23cm.cn/pallets-manufacturer5095) come in numerous setups, each serving unique functions. The following are the most typical types:
Stringer Pallets: These pallets are identified by their use of constant longitudinal pieces of wood (called stringers) that supply structural support. Typically, stringer pallets can be either two-way or four-way, allowing forklifts to enter from different angles.
Block Pallets: Composed of blocks that form a grid structure, these pallets offer greater stability and can be easily maneuvered from all sides. Block pallets are especially useful for heavy loads.
Perimeter Base Pallets: This style includes assistance only on the edges of the pallet. They are usually lightweight and are chosen for lighter item applications.

Frequently Asked Questions About Industrial Wooden PalletsQ1: What is the basic size of a wooden pallet?
A: The most common size for a wooden pallet in the United States is 48 inches by 40 inches. In Europe, the standard size is 47.2 inches by 31.5 inches for Euro pallets.
Q2: Can wooden pallets be used for foodstuff?
A: Yes, wooden pallets can be used for food items, but they need to adhere to security policies, such as sanitation and treatment standards, to prevent contamination.
Q3: How long do wooden pallets normally last?
A: The life expectancy of a wooden pallet varies based on usage and ecological aspects; nevertheless, a well-maintained wooden pallet can last for several years.
Q4: Are wooden pallets eco-friendly?
A: Yes, wooden pallets are a sustainable option, as they are made from sustainable resources and can be reused or recycled, decreasing waste.
Q5: How can I repair a broken wooden pallet?
A: Simply replace broken boards or blocks with new ones. Make certain to use proper products comparable to the initial design to preserve safety and stability.
